Searched refs:tv_nsec (Results 1 - 25 of 437) sorted by relevance

1234567891011>>

/linux-master/tools/testing/selftests/bpf/progs/
H A Dtest_vmlinux.c22 long tv_nsec; local
28 if (bpf_probe_read_user(&tv_nsec, sizeof(ts->tv_nsec), &ts->tv_nsec) ||
29 tv_nsec != MY_TV_NSEC)
40 long tv_nsec; local
46 if (bpf_probe_read_user(&tv_nsec, sizeof(ts->tv_nsec), &ts->tv_nsec) ||
47 tv_nsec !
58 long tv_nsec; local
[all...]
/linux-master/include/vdso/
H A Dtime32.h9 s32 tv_nsec; member in struct:old_timespec32
/linux-master/include/linux/
H A Dtime64.h15 long tv_nsec; /* nanoseconds */ member in struct:timespec64
49 return (a->tv_sec == b->tv_sec) && (a->tv_nsec == b->tv_nsec);
63 return lhs->tv_nsec - rhs->tv_nsec;
73 lhs.tv_nsec + rhs.tv_nsec);
85 lhs.tv_nsec - rhs.tv_nsec);
98 if ((unsigned long)ts->tv_nsec >
[all...]
/linux-master/fs/ext4/
H A Dinode-test.c89 .expected = {.tv_sec = -0x80000000LL, .tv_nsec = 0L},
97 .expected = {.tv_sec = -1LL, .tv_nsec = 0L},
113 .expected = {.tv_sec = 0x7fffffffLL, .tv_nsec = 0L},
121 .expected = {.tv_sec = 0x80000000LL, .tv_nsec = 0L},
129 .expected = {.tv_sec = 0xffffffffLL, .tv_nsec = 0L},
137 .expected = {.tv_sec = 0x100000000LL, .tv_nsec = 0L},
145 .expected = {.tv_sec = 0x17fffffffLL, .tv_nsec = 0L},
153 .expected = {.tv_sec = 0x180000000LL, .tv_nsec = 0L},
161 .expected = {.tv_sec = 0x1ffffffffLL, .tv_nsec = 0L},
169 .expected = {.tv_sec = 0x200000000LL, .tv_nsec
[all...]
/linux-master/fs/
H A Dutimes.c28 if (!nsec_valid(times[0].tv_nsec) ||
29 !nsec_valid(times[1].tv_nsec))
31 if (times[0].tv_nsec == UTIME_NOW &&
32 times[1].tv_nsec == UTIME_NOW)
42 if (times[0].tv_nsec == UTIME_OMIT)
44 else if (times[0].tv_nsec != UTIME_NOW) {
49 if (times[1].tv_nsec == UTIME_OMIT)
51 else if (times[1].tv_nsec != UTIME_NOW) {
159 if (tstimes[0].tv_nsec == UTIME_OMIT &&
160 tstimes[1].tv_nsec
[all...]
/linux-master/include/uapi/linux/
H A Dtime_types.h9 long long tv_nsec; /* nanoseconds */ member in struct:__kernel_timespec
33 long tv_nsec; /* nanoseconds */ member in struct:__kernel_old_timespec
/linux-master/fs/fat/
H A Dfat_test.c35 .ts = {.tv_sec = 315532800LL, .tv_nsec = 0L},
43 .ts = {.tv_sec = 4354819198LL, .tv_nsec = 0L},
51 .ts = {.tv_sec = 315493200LL, .tv_nsec = 0L},
59 .ts = {.tv_sec = 4354858798LL, .tv_nsec = 0L},
67 .ts = {.tv_sec = 825552000LL, .tv_nsec = 0L},
75 .ts = {.tv_sec = 951782400LL, .tv_nsec = 0L},
83 .ts = {.tv_sec = 4107542400LL, .tv_nsec = 0L},
91 .ts = {.tv_sec = 1078014600LL, .tv_nsec = 0L},
99 .ts = {.tv_sec = 1078097400LL, .tv_nsec = 0L},
107 .ts = {.tv_sec = 946684799LL, .tv_nsec
[all...]
/linux-master/fs/hfs/
H A Dsysdep.c33 inode_set_ctime(inode, ts.tv_sec + diff, ts.tv_nsec);
35 inode_set_atime(inode, ts.tv_sec + diff, ts.tv_nsec);
37 inode_set_mtime(inode, ts.tv_sec + diff, ts.tv_nsec);
/linux-master/arch/um/os-Linux/
H A Dtime.c23 return ((long long) ts->tv_sec * UM_NSEC_PER_SEC) + ts->tv_nsec;
52 its.it_value.tv_nsec = nsecs % UM_NSEC_PER_SEC;
55 its.it_interval.tv_nsec = nsecs % UM_NSEC_PER_SEC;
67 .it_value.tv_nsec = nsecs % UM_NSEC_PER_SEC,
70 .it_interval.tv_nsec = 0, // we cheat here
111 if (its.it_value.tv_sec || its.it_value.tv_nsec)
/linux-master/arch/mips/loongson2ef/common/
H A Dtime.c27 ts->tv_nsec = 0;
/linux-master/sound/core/seq/
H A Dseq_timer.h77 if ((a->tv_sec == b->tv_sec) && (a->tv_nsec >= b->tv_nsec))
85 while (tm->tv_nsec >= 1000000000) {
87 tm->tv_nsec -= 1000000000;
97 tm->tv_nsec += inc->tv_nsec;
103 tm->tv_nsec += nsec;
/linux-master/tools/testing/selftests/timers/
H A Dmqueue-lat.c42 long long ret = NSEC_PER_SEC * b.tv_sec + b.tv_nsec;
44 ret -= NSEC_PER_SEC * a.tv_sec + a.tv_nsec;
50 ts.tv_nsec += ns;
51 while (ts.tv_nsec >= NSEC_PER_SEC) {
52 ts.tv_nsec -= NSEC_PER_SEC;
H A Dnanosleep.c86 if (a.tv_nsec > b.tv_nsec)
93 ts.tv_nsec += ns;
94 while (ts.tv_nsec >= NSEC_PER_SEC) {
95 ts.tv_nsec -= NSEC_PER_SEC;
120 rel.tv_nsec = 0;
H A Dnsleep-lat.c81 ts.tv_nsec += ns;
82 while (ts.tv_nsec >= NSEC_PER_SEC) {
83 ts.tv_nsec -= NSEC_PER_SEC;
92 long long ret = NSEC_PER_SEC * b.tv_sec + b.tv_nsec;
94 ret -= NSEC_PER_SEC * a.tv_sec + a.tv_nsec;
105 target.tv_nsec = ns%NSEC_PER_SEC;
H A Dalarmtimer-suspend.c89 long long ret = NSEC_PER_SEC * b.tv_sec + b.tv_nsec;
91 ret -= NSEC_PER_SEC * a.tv_sec + a.tv_nsec;
109 ts.tv_nsec, delta_ns);
152 start_time.tv_sec, start_time.tv_nsec);
157 its1.it_interval.tv_nsec = 0;
H A Dinconsistency-check.c87 if (a.tv_nsec > b.tv_nsec)
130 list[i].tv_nsec);
135 delta += list[inconsistent].tv_nsec;
137 delta -= list[inconsistent+1].tv_nsec;
/linux-master/tools/testing/selftests/timens/
H A Dfutex.c30 timeout.tv_nsec += NSEC_PER_SEC / 10; // 100ms
31 if (timeout.tv_nsec > NSEC_PER_SEC) {
33 timeout.tv_nsec -= NSEC_PER_SEC;
51 (end.tv_sec == timeout.tv_sec && end.tv_nsec < timeout.tv_nsec)) {
/linux-master/fs/udf/
H A Dudftime.c49 dest->tv_nsec = 1000 * (src.centiseconds * 10000 +
55 dest->tv_nsec %= NSEC_PER_SEC;
77 dest->centiseconds = ts.tv_nsec / 10000000;
78 dest->hundredsOfMicroseconds = (ts.tv_nsec / 1000 -
80 dest->microseconds = (ts.tv_nsec / 1000 - dest->centiseconds * 10000 -
/linux-master/tools/testing/selftests/powerpc/benchmarks/
H A Dfutex_bench.c34 printf("time = %.6f\n", ts_end.tv_sec - ts_start.tv_sec + (ts_end.tv_nsec - ts_start.tv_nsec) / 1e9);
/linux-master/tools/testing/radix-tree/
H A Dbenchmark.c39 (finish.tv_nsec - start.tv_nsec);
67 (finish.tv_nsec - start.tv_nsec);
88 (finish.tv_nsec - start.tv_nsec);
109 (finish.tv_nsec - start.tv_nsec);
/linux-master/tools/testing/selftests/futex/functional/
H A Dfutex_wait_wouldblock.c42 struct timespec to = {.tv_sec = 0, .tv_nsec = timeout_ns};
91 to.tv_nsec += timeout_ns;
93 if (to.tv_nsec >= 1000000000) {
95 to.tv_nsec -= 1000000000;
/linux-master/fs/proc/
H A Duptime.c32 idle.tv_nsec = rem;
35 (uptime.tv_nsec / (NSEC_PER_SEC / 100)),
37 (idle.tv_nsec / (NSEC_PER_SEC / 100)));
/linux-master/kernel/time/
H A Dtime.c89 tv.tv_nsec = 0;
127 tv.tv_nsec = 0;
148 put_user(ts.tv_nsec / 1000, &tv->tv_usec))
207 get_user(new_ts.tv_nsec, &tv->tv_usec))
210 if (new_ts.tv_nsec > USEC_PER_SEC || new_ts.tv_nsec < 0)
213 new_ts.tv_nsec *= NSEC_PER_USEC;
232 put_user(ts.tv_nsec / 1000, &tv->tv_usec))
251 get_user(new_ts.tv_nsec, &tv->tv_usec))
254 if (new_ts.tv_nsec > USEC_PER_SE
[all...]
/linux-master/tools/testing/selftests/mqueue/
H A Dmq_perf_tests.c359 (middle.tv_nsec - start.tv_nsec); \
360 send_total.tv_nsec += nsec; \
361 if (send_total.tv_nsec >= 1000000000) { \
363 send_total.tv_nsec -= 1000000000; \
366 (end.tv_nsec - middle.tv_nsec); \
367 recv_total.tv_nsec += nsec; \
368 if (recv_total.tv_nsec >= 1000000000) { \
370 recv_total.tv_nsec
[all...]
/linux-master/tools/testing/selftests/kvm/
H A Ddirty_log_perf_test.c106 ts_diff.tv_nsec);
110 ts_diff.tv_nsec);
125 total.tv_sec, total.tv_nsec, avg.tv_sec, avg.tv_nsec);
205 ts_diff.tv_sec, ts_diff.tv_nsec);
212 ts_diff.tv_sec, ts_diff.tv_nsec);
235 iteration, ts_diff.tv_sec, ts_diff.tv_nsec);
243 iteration, ts_diff.tv_sec, ts_diff.tv_nsec);
253 iteration, ts_diff.tv_sec, ts_diff.tv_nsec);
270 ts_diff.tv_sec, ts_diff.tv_nsec);
[all...]

Completed in 176 milliseconds

1234567891011>>